Substance abuse treatment facilities in Pennsylvania offer a range of services tailored to address the unique needs of individuals seeking recovery from substance use disorders. These treatment centers typically provide both inpatient and outpatient options, ensuring that individuals can access the level of care that best suits their circumstances.

Inpatient substance abuse treatment in Pennsylvania involves a residential setting where individuals reside at the facility for the duration of their treatment. This type of program offers a highly structured and supervised environment, which can be particularly beneficial for those with severe addiction issues or a history of relapse. Patients in inpatient programs receive 24/7 medical and therapeutic support, allowing them to focus solely on their recovery. Pennsylvania boasts a variety of inpatient treatment centers, each offering a range of specialized services and treatment modalities to cater to diverse needs.

Similarly, outpatient substance abuse treatment is also widely available throughout the state. This form of treatment allows individuals to maintain their daily responsibilities while attending scheduled therapy sessions and receiving support. Outpatient programs are versatile, accommodating individuals who require a less intensive level of care, as well as those transitioning from inpatient treatment. Pennsylvania's outpatient centers provide comprehensive counseling, group therapy, and access to support networks vital to successful recovery.

Additionally, Pennsylvania offers gender-specific substance abuse treatment options. Men-only and women-only treatment centers provide a safe and supportive environment where individuals can focus on their recovery without distractions. These facilities recognize the importance of addressing gender-specific issues and offer specialized programs that cater to the unique needs and challenges faced by men and women during their journey towards sobriety.

For those seeking a more luxurious and personalized treatment experience, some substance abuse treatment centers in Pennsylvania offer luxury or upscale options. These facilities provide a higher level of comfort and privacy, often in serene settings, to create an atmosphere conducive to healing. While these programs may come at a premium cost, they aim to provide a comprehensive and holistic approach to recovery, often including additional amenities and therapies such as spa treatments, gourmet meals, and holistic wellness activities.

In summary, Pennsylvania offers a wide array of substance abuse treatment options, including inpatient and outpatient programs, gender-specific facilities, and luxury treatment centers. These diverse choices ensure that individuals struggling with substance use disorders can access the appropriate level of care and support to embark on their path to recovery within the confines of the state.

Frequently Asked Questions About Substance Abuse Treatment in Pennsylvania

What are the most common signs and symptoms of substance use disorders in Pennsylvania, and when should one seek treatment?

Common signs of substance use disorders in Pennsylvania include cravings, withdrawal symptoms, neglect of responsibilities, and social isolation. Individuals should seek treatment when these signs interfere with daily life, relationships, or physical and mental health, indicating the need for professional help.

How can individuals in Pennsylvania find a suitable substance abuse treatment program that aligns with their needs and preferences?

To find a suitable substance abuse treatment program in Pennsylvania, individuals can start by assessing their specific needs, preferences, and treatment goals. They can then research treatment centers, consider factors like treatment approaches, location, and cost, and consult with treatment professionals for guidance in making an informed decision.

What is the role of medication-assisted treatment (MAT) in opioid addiction treatment in Pennsylvania, and how does it work?

Medication-assisted treatment (MAT) is a crucial component of opioid addiction treatment in Pennsylvania. It combines medications like methadone, buprenorphine, or naltrexone with counseling and therapy. MAT helps individuals manage cravings, reduce withdrawal symptoms, and stabilize their lives, increasing the likelihood of successful recovery.

Are there specialized substance abuse treatment programs for veterans and military personnel in Pennsylvania?

Yes, Pennsylvania offers specialized substance abuse treatment programs for veterans and military personnel. These programs recognize the unique needs and experiences of veterans and provide tailored services to address addiction-related issues, including post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) and military-related trauma.

How can families and loved ones support someone in Pennsylvania who is undergoing substance abuse treatment and recovery?

Families and loved ones can support someone in Pennsylvania undergoing substance abuse treatment and recovery by attending family therapy, participating in support groups, educating themselves about addiction, offering emotional support, and assisting with relapse prevention strategies. Involvement and understanding can significantly aid the recovery process.

What are the available options for individuals seeking outpatient substance abuse treatment in Pennsylvania?

Pennsylvania offers various outpatient substance abuse treatment options, including standard outpatient programs and intensive outpatient programs (IOPs). These programs provide flexibility for individuals to receive treatment while maintaining their daily responsibilities and support systems, making it suitable for many individuals seeking recovery.

What financial assistance and insurance options are available for individuals who cannot afford substance abuse treatment in Pennsylvania?

Pennsylvania offers financial assistance and insurance options for individuals who cannot afford substance abuse treatment. These include Medicaid, state-funded programs, sliding scale fees based on income, and assistance from nonprofit organizations and community resources, ensuring that treatment is accessible to all who need it.

Can individuals in Pennsylvania access telehealth or online substance abuse treatment services as an alternative to in-person treatment?

Yes, individuals in Pennsylvania can access telehealth or online substance abuse treatment services as an alternative to in-person treatment. Telehealth provides a convenient and accessible way to receive counseling, therapy, and support, especially useful for individuals in remote areas or during times when in-person visits may be challenging, such as during a pandemic.

Are there substance abuse treatment programs in Pennsylvania that cater to the needs of pregnant women and individuals with young children?

Yes, Pennsylvania offers substance abuse treatment programs that cater to the needs of pregnant women and individuals with young children. These programs provide comprehensive care that addresses prenatal care, parenting support, and addiction treatment, ensuring the well-being of both mothers and their children during the recovery process.
